BATTERY INSTALLATION
Your NAUTICO3 radio operates with either 4 AA alkaline batteries or 
an optional NiMH battery pack. The belt clip should be removed (see 
below) to ease installation or removal of the batteries.
To install the batteries:
1. With the back of the radio facing you, remove the belt clip (see 
diagram below) for easy access, then remove the Battery Cover 
by pulling down the Battery Cover Latch and lifting up the Battery 
Cover from the radio.
2. Insert 4 AA batteries observing the polarity as shown. Installing the 
batteries incorrectly will prevent the radio from operating or may 
damage the radio.
3. Return the Battery Cover by sliding it up on the radio and push up 
the Battery Cover Latch until it locks into place. Replace the belt 
clip, making sure it locks into place.

INSTALLING THE BELT CLIP
To install the 
BELT CLIP, slide the clip down into 
the slot on the back of the radio until the 
BELT 
CLIP LATCH clicks. To remove the BELT CLIP
press the 
LOCK TAB up, then gently pull the belt 
clip up toward the top of the radio.
